About the piece

This 1740 portrait by Ján Gottlieb Kramer captures a young nobleman in elaborate ceremonial costume, showcasing the intricate embroidery and rich textiles of the mid-18th century. The subject is framed by a voluminous gold cloak and set against a dark, atmospheric background that highlights his dignified presence and the familial coat of arms in the upper corner.
